Tiny 10 is a heavily modified, stripped-down version of Microsoft Windows 10, created by a developer known as NTDEV. The goal of Tiny 10 is simple: remove every possible non-essential component of Windows 10 to create a version that is incredibly lightweight, fast, and usable on hardware that Microsoft officially abandoned years ago.

While a standard Windows 10 installation consumes 20–30 GB of storage and runs dozens of background processes, Tiny 10 can run on as little as 5–7 GB of disk space and uses less than 1 GB of RAM at idle.

Independent testers (including Tech YES City, Linus Tech Tips’ community, and multiple Reddit threads) have benchmarked Tiny 10 against stock Windows 10 on low-end hardware:

| Test | Stock Windows 10 (2GB RAM) | Tiny 10 (2GB RAM) | |------|----------------------------|--------------------| | Boot time (cold) | 78 seconds | 22 seconds | | RAM usage at idle | 1.8 GB | 650 MB | | Disk space after updates | 28 GB | 6.2 GB | | Process count | 135+ | 45 | | Cinebench R15 (single-core) | 98 pts | 97 pts (no loss) |

Real-world experience: On a 2012 laptop with a mechanical HDD and 2GB RAM, stock Windows 10 is nearly unusable—disk thrashing, 5-minute boot times, constant freezing. Tiny 10 transforms the same machine into a usable web browsing and document editing device.

The Tiny 10 project on GitHub has become a beacon for users seeking to breathe new life into aging hardware or maximize performance on modern systems. Developed by NTDEV, Tiny 10 is a specialized "debloated" version of Windows 10 designed to run on the bare minimum of resources.

By stripping away the telemetry, bloatware, and non-essential services that typically bog down Microsoft’s operating system, Tiny 10 offers a streamlined experience that feels lightning-fast. 🚀 What Makes Tiny 10 Different?

Standard Windows 10 installations often consume upwards of 20GB of disk space and require at least 2GB of RAM just to idle. Tiny 10 shatters these requirements:

Ultra-Light Footprint: The ISO size is significantly smaller than the official Microsoft release.

Minimal RAM Usage: It can idle on as little as 200MB to 500MB of RAM.

Storage Efficiency: The installed OS takes up roughly 5GB to 8GB of space. ⚠️ Many fake “Tiny 10” repos exist —

Legacy PCs: Perfect for laptops from the 2010–2015 era with limited RAM.

Virtual Machines (VMs): Ideal for lightweight testing environments where you don't want to allocate 4GB+ of RAM.

Gaming: Some users prefer it to minimize background CPU usage during high-intensity gaming sessions.

Single-Purpose Machines: Great for kiosks, arcade cabinets, or dedicated media servers. ⚠️ Security and Ethics Warning

Tiny 10 is a "modded" version of Windows. Because it is not an official Microsoft product, you should always:

Verify Sources: Only download from reputable links provided by NTDEV.

Check Licenses: You still need a valid Windows 10 license key to activate the OS; Tiny 10 is not a "cracked" or free version of Windows.

Avoid Sensitive Data: It is generally recommended to avoid using modded OS versions for banking or sensitive professional work, as the removal of certain security services can alter the threat model of the machine.

Tiny10 is an unofficial, heavily debloated version of Windows 10 designed for low-end hardware and older PCs. Created by the developer and YouTuber NTDEV, it aims to provide a lightweight, high-performance operating system by removing unnecessary components, services, and bloatware. Tiny10 on GitHub

While NTDEV often shares official ISO links via platforms like Archive.org, the GitHub ecosystem plays a critical role in the community around Tiny10:

Scripts and Builders: Several repositories, such as cursedverses/tiny10builder, provide open-source scripts that automate the creation of these streamlined images from official Microsoft ISOs using tools like DISM.

Alternative Versions: Other developers host their own variations or modifications on GitHub, such as L36D/Tiny10, which targets ultra-minimal builds (as small as 1GB).

Issue Tracking and Discussion: GitHub is used by the community to request features, such as a "Tiny10 Builder" for specific versions like Win10 Pro, or to report success with booting images via tools like Ventoy.

VM Integration: Projects like quickemu have seen community requests to include Tiny10 as a standard option because of its efficiency in Virtual Machines (VMs). Key Features and Benefits
